CCs are a common footwork move used to add rhythm, direction changes, and flow. They help breakers move between footwork patterns and add sharp accents to the beat.

Prerequisites

  • Six-step basics
  • Hip mobility
  • Floor control

Common mistakes

  • Kicking without control
  • Letting the hips collapse
  • Not switching weight properly

What to notice

Look at the kick, the weight switch, and the timing. CCs are useful because they can hit accents in the music and make footwork look sharper without needing a big trick.
